Ian Wright took aim at the fans who booed Alex Iwobi off the pitch at Huddersfield…


 

Arsenal legend Ian Wright launched a passionate defence of Alex Iwobi and slammed the fans who jeered the Nigerian international as he was substituted at Huddersfield.

Speaking via his YouTube channel, a disappointed Wright couldn’t understand why our own fans were attacking a player who’s come through the academy and scored in a game in which we claimed all three points.

Admittedly, the 22-year-old didn’t have the best of games, but his directness and willingness to attack Huddersfield’s defence was admirable.

In a 3-4-3 system favoured by Unai Emery in recent weeks, Iwobi is tasked to collect the ball on the half-turn between the lines and create overloads against the opposition’s full-backs.

He has, for the most part, delivered what has been asked of him, though his end product as he reaches the final third can be rather inconsistent.

As a wide player, you’re likely to lose possession more frequently than other players given that it’s your job to attack the opposition and provoke.

For Wrighty, though, there is no explanation for the abuse Iwobi continues to receive – especially given that he’s an academy graduate.

“What has happened to us, to Arsenal fans now?” Our former record goalscorer said.

“Especially the away fans, the hardcore fans who go away, travelling all other the place, losing patience with a young Londoner, an academy player, trying his very best.

“We need to reset and get behind the boys again, especially people like Alex Iwobi. He needs it more than anybody now. He tries to be progressive when he plays.

“It’s embarrassing and I feel sorry for him.”
